Ashgrid Roof Spacer System
Bradford Ashgrid Roof Spacer System is a modular roof raiser designed for commercial and industrial purlin roofs. The system raises the roof sheet above the purlin, creating a defined space between the safety mesh and roof sheet for insulation. Bradford Ashgrid consists of galvanised bars and supporting brackets pre-assembled in 1200 mm sections. Backed by decades of use in Europe and tested for both cyclonic and non-cyclonic conditions, Bradford Ashgrid is a proven choice among roofing spacers.
Features and Benefits
Bradford Ashgrid Roof Spacer System supports compliance, stability, and performance in metal roofing applications. Safe-Locâ„¢ connections ensure bar joints cannot be accidentally separated once engaged, while still allowing joints to be unlocked on site if required. Bracket heights position insulation blankets at their design thickness, contributing to BCA-compliant total R-Values. Pre-loaded corrosion-resistant screws and high-strength bracket design provide assurance in both non-cyclonic and cyclonic conditions.
